In a RGB color space, hex #b16685 is composed of 69.4% red, 40%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.4% magenta, 24.9%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 335.2 degrees, a saturation of 32.5% and a lightness of 54.7%. #b16685 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ffccff with #63000b.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030102 is the darkest color, while #faf5f7 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8a8b is the less saturated color, while #f81f79 is the most saturated one.
